What is TraceEng.dll?
A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is like a special kind of computer file that stores code and data to be used by more than one program at the same time. The TraceEng.dll file, in particular, is a part of the software Open Text HostExplorer 14 and plays an important role in its functioning. This file contains code and instructions that help the HostExplorer 14 software to perform specific tasks, like tracing and debugging programs.
In the context of Open Text HostExplorer 14, TraceEng.dll is crucial because it provides essential functions that the software needs to work properly. It helps the software to keep track of what's happening inside the computer's memory and troubleshoot any issues that might come up while running the software. Without TraceEng.dll, the HostExplorer 14 software might not be able to function correctly or efficiently, so it's a key part of the overall system.
Common Issues and Errors Related to TraceEng.dll
Although essential for system performance, dynamic Link Library (DLL) files can occasionally cause specific errors. The following enumerates some of the most common DLL errors users encounter while operating their systems:
- TraceEng.dll not found: This indicates that the application you're trying to run is looking for a specific DLL file that it can't locate. This could be due to the DLL file being missing, corrupted, or incorrectly installed.
- TraceEng.dll Access Violation: This indicates a process tried to access or modify a memory location related to TraceEng.dll that it isn't allowed to. This is often a sign of problems with the software using the DLL, such as bugs or corruption.
- This application failed to start because TraceEng.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error message is a sign that a DLL file that the application relies on is not present in the system. Reinstalling the application may install the missing DLL file and fix the problem.
- The file TraceEng.dll is missing: The specified DLL file couldn't be found. It may have been unintentionally deleted or moved from its original location.
- TraceEng.dll could not be loaded: This error suggests that the system was unable to load the DLL file into memory. This could happen due to file corruption, incompatibility, or because the file is missing or incorrectly installed.
